◆ offsetAndScaleImage()

void osgVolume::ImageLayer::offsetAndScaleImage ( const osg::Vec4 & offset,
const osg::Vec4 & scale )

Apply color transformation to pixels using c' = offset + c * scale .

◆ rescaleToZeroToOneRange()

void osgVolume::ImageLayer::rescaleToZeroToOneRange ( )

Compute the min max range of the image, and then remap this to a 0 to 1 range.

◆ translateMinToZero()

void osgVolume::ImageLayer::translateMinToZero ( )

Compute the min color component of the image and then translate and pixels by this offset to make the new min component 0.
